Science
Nobel Prizes in Science
Chemistry: Adolf von Baeyer (Germany), for work on organic dyes and hydroaromatic combinations Physics: Philipp Lenard (Germany), for work with cathode rays Physiology or Medicine: Robert Koch (Germany), for work on tuberculosis
